有一座隐藏在网站深处的珍贵宝藏,名为GraphQL。这个强大而灵活的API查询语言,为数据抓取者们提供了一个绝佳机会,即逆向工程API进行抓取。

在这片黄金矿场里,你可以挖掘到无尽的数据宝藏,而不再受限于传统的API限制。怎样才能在这片矿藏中获得丰厚回报呢?

首先,你需要了解GraphQL的工作原理。与RESTful API不同,GraphQL允许你根据自己的需求来灵活构建你的查询,而不是被动接受服务器返回的固定数据。这意味着你可以精确获取你所需要的数据,而不必不必请求过多或过少的信息。

其次,你需要工具和技巧。借助GraphQL的强大功能,你可以使用开源工具如GraphiQL来直接与API交互,并发现数据的模式和结构。此外,你还可以通过抓包工具来分析网站的GraphQL请求,找出接口的URL和参数,为进一步抓取做准备。

最后,你需要谨慎行事。尽管GraphQL提供了更大的灵活性和控制权,但你仍需遵守网站的使用条款和隐私政策,确保你的抓取行为合法合规。同时,要注意API的频率限制,避免对服务器造成过大负担。

在这片神秘的GraphQL黄金矿场里,你将发现无尽的可能性和机遇。只要你掌握了逆向工程API的技巧,你就能够从中获得丰厚的回报。赶快开始你的探险之旅,挖掘属于你的数据宝藏吧!

详情参考

了解更多有趣的事情:https://blog.ds3783.com/